 static int vp9_raw_reorder_frame_parse(AVBSFContext *bsf, VP9RawReorderFrame *frame)
 {
     GetBitContext bc;
     int err;
 
     unsigned int frame_marker;
     unsigned int profile_low_bit, profile_high_bit, reserved_zero;
     unsigned int error_resilient_mode;
     unsigned int frame_sync_code;
 
     err = init_get_bits(&bc, frame->packet->data, 8 * frame->packet->size);
     if (err)
         return err;
 
     frame_marker = get_bits(&bc, 2);
     if (frame_marker != 2) {
         av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Invalid frame marker: %u.\n",
                frame_marker);
         return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
     }
 
     profile_low_bit  = get_bits1(&bc);
     profile_high_bit = get_bits1(&bc);
     frame->profile = (profile_high_bit << 1) | profile_low_bit;
     if (frame->profile == 3) {
         reserved_zero = get_bits1(&bc);
         if (reserved_zero != 0) {
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Profile reserved_zero bit set: "
                    "unsupported profile or invalid bitstream.\n");
             return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
         }
     }
 
     frame->show_existing_frame = get_bits1(&bc);
     if (frame->show_existing_frame) {
         frame->frame_to_show = get_bits(&bc, 3);
         return 0;
     }
 
     frame->frame_type = get_bits1(&bc);
     frame->show_frame = get_bits1(&bc);
     error_resilient_mode = get_bits1(&bc);
 
     if (frame->frame_type == 0) {
         frame_sync_code = get_bits(&bc, 24);
         if (frame_sync_code != 0x498342) {
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Invalid frame sync code: %06x.\n",
                    frame_sync_code);
             return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
         }
         frame->refresh_frame_flags = 0xff;
     } else {
         unsigned int intra_only;
 
         if (frame->show_frame == 0)
             intra_only = get_bits1(&bc);
         else
             intra_only = 0;
         if (error_resilient_mode == 0) {
             // reset_frame_context
             skip_bits(&bc, 2);
         }
         if (intra_only) {
             frame_sync_code = get_bits(&bc, 24);
             if (frame_sync_code != 0x498342) {
                 av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Invalid frame sync code: "
                        "%06x.\n", frame_sync_code);
                 return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
             }
             if (frame->profile > 0) {
                 unsigned int color_space;
                 if (frame->profile >= 2) {
                     // ten_or_twelve_bit
                     skip_bits(&bc, 1);
                 }
                 color_space = get_bits(&bc, 3);
                 if (color_space != 7 /* CS_RGB */) {
                     // color_range
                     skip_bits(&bc, 1);
                     if (frame->profile == 1 || frame->profile == 3) {
                         // subsampling
                         skip_bits(&bc, 3);
                     }
                 } else {
                     if (frame->profile == 1 || frame->profile == 3)
                         skip_bits(&bc, 1);
                 }
             }
             frame->refresh_frame_flags = get_bits(&bc, 8);
         } else {
             frame->refresh_frame_flags = get_bits(&bc, 8);
         }
     }
 
     return 0;
 }
 
 static int vp9_raw_reorder_make_output(AVBSFContext *bsf,
                                    AVPacket *out,
                                    VP9RawReorderFrame *last_frame)
 {
     VP9RawReorderContext *ctx = bsf->priv_data;
     VP9RawReorderFrame *next_output = last_frame,
                       *next_display = last_frame, *frame;
     int s, err;
 
     for (s = 0; s < FRAME_SLOTS; s++) {
         frame = ctx->slot[s];
         if (!frame)
             continue;
         if (frame->needs_output && (!next_output ||
             frame->sequence < next_output->sequence))
             next_output = frame;
         if (frame->needs_display && (!next_display ||
             frame->pts < next_display->pts))
             next_display = frame;
     }
 
     if (!next_output && !next_display)
         return AVERROR_EOF;
 
     if (!next_display || (next_output &&
         next_output->sequence < next_display->sequence))
         frame = next_output;
     else
         frame = next_display;
 
     if (frame->needs_output && frame->needs_display &&
         next_output == next_display) {
         av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"Output and display frame "
                "%"PRId64" (%"PRId64") in order.\n",
                frame->sequence, frame->pts);
 
         av_packet_move_ref(out, frame->packet);
 
         frame->needs_output = frame->needs_display = 0;
     } else if (frame->needs_output) {
         if (frame->needs_display) {
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"Output frame %"PRId64" "
                    "(%"PRId64") for later display.\n",
                    frame->sequence, frame->pts);
         } else {
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"Output unshown frame "
                    "%"PRId64" (%"PRId64") to keep order.\n",
                    frame->sequence, frame->pts);
         }
 
         av_packet_move_ref(out, frame->packet);
         out->pts = out->dts;
 
         frame->needs_output = 0;
     } else {
         PutBitContext pb;
 
         av_assert0(!frame->needs_output && frame->needs_display);
 
         if (frame->slots == 0) {
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Attempting to display frame "
                    "which is no longer available?\n");
             frame->needs_display = 0;
             return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
         }
 
         s = ff_ctz(frame->slots);
         av_assert0(s < FRAME_SLOTS);
 
         av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"Display frame %"PRId64" "
                "(%"PRId64") from slot %d.\n",
                frame->sequence, frame->pts, s);
 
         err = av_new_packet(out, 2);
         if (err < 0)
             return err;
 
         init_put_bits(&pb, out->data, 2);
 
         // frame_marker
         put_bits(&pb, 2, 2);
         // profile_low_bit
         put_bits(&pb, 1, frame->profile & 1);
         // profile_high_bit
         put_bits(&pb, 1, (frame->profile >> 1) & 1);
         if (frame->profile == 3) {
             // reserved_zero
             put_bits(&pb, 1, 0);
         }
         // show_existing_frame
         put_bits(&pb, 1, 1);
         // frame_to_show_map_idx
         put_bits(&pb, 3, s);
 
         while (put_bits_count(&pb) < 16)
             put_bits(&pb, 1, 0);
 
         flush_put_bits(&pb);
         out->pts = out->dts = frame->pts;
 
         frame->needs_display = 0;
     }
 
     return 0;
 }
 
 static int vp9_raw_reorder_filter(AVBSFContext *bsf, AVPacket *out)
 {
     VP9RawReorderContext *ctx = bsf->priv_data;
     VP9RawReorderFrame *frame;
     AVPacket *in;
     int err, s;
 
     if (ctx->next_frame) {
         frame = ctx->next_frame;
 
     } else {
         err = ff_bsf_get_packet(bsf, &in);
         if (err < 0) {
             if (err == AVERROR_EOF)
                 return vp9_raw_reorder_make_output(bsf, out, NULL);
             return err;
         }
 
         if (in->data[in->size - 1] & 0xe0 == 0xc0) {
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Input in superframes is not "
                    "supported.\n");
             av_packet_free(&in);
             return AVERROR(ENOSYS);
         }
 
         frame = av_mallocz(sizeof(*frame));
         if (!frame) {
             av_packet_free(&in);
             return AVERROR(ENOMEM);
         }
 
         frame->packet   = in;
         frame->pts      = in->pts;
         frame->sequence = ++ctx->sequence;
         err = vp9_raw_reorder_frame_parse(bsf, frame);
         if (err) {
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Failed to parse input "
                    "frame: %d.\n", err);
             goto fail;
         }
 
         frame->needs_output  = 1;
         frame->needs_display = frame->pts != AV_NOPTS_VALUE;
 
         if (frame->show_existing_frame)
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"Show frame %"PRId64" "
                    "(%"PRId64"): show %u.\n", frame->sequence,
                    frame->pts, frame->frame_to_show);
         else
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"New frame %"PRId64" "
                    "(%"PRId64"): type %u show %u refresh %02x.\n",
                    frame->sequence, frame->pts, frame->frame_type,
                    frame->show_frame, frame->refresh_frame_flags);
 
         ctx->next_frame = frame;
     }
 
     for (s = 0; s < FRAME_SLOTS; s++) {
         if (!(frame->refresh_frame_flags & (1 << s)))
             continue;
         if (ctx->slot[s] && ctx->slot[s]->needs_display &&
             ctx->slot[s]->slots == (1 << s)) {
             // We are overwriting this slot, which is last reference
             // to the frame previously present in it.  In order to be
             // a valid stream, that frame must already have been
             // displayed before the pts of the current frame.
             err = vp9_raw_reorder_make_output(bsf, out, ctx->slot[s]);
             if (err < 0) {
                 av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Failed to create "
                        "output overwriting slot %d: %d.\n",
                        s, err);
                 // Clear the slot anyway, so we don't end up
                 // in an infinite loop.
                 vp9_raw_reorder_clear_slot(ctx, s);
                 return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
             }
             return 0;
         }
         vp9_raw_reorder_clear_slot(ctx, s);
     }
 
     for (s = 0; s < FRAME_SLOTS; s++) {
         if (!(frame->refresh_frame_flags & (1 << s)))
             continue;
         ctx->slot[s] = frame;
     }
     frame->slots = frame->refresh_frame_flags;
 
     if (!frame->refresh_frame_flags) {
         err = vp9_raw_reorder_make_output(bsf, out, frame);
         if (err < 0) {
             av_log(bsf,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Failed to create output "
                    "for transient frame.\n");
             ctx->next_frame = NULL;
             return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
         }
         if (!frame->needs_display) {
             vp9_raw_reorder_frame_free(&frame);
             ctx->next_frame = NULL;
         }
         return 0;
     }
 
     ctx->next_frame = NULL;
     return AVERROR(EAGAIN);
 
 fail:
     vp9_raw_reorder_frame_free(&frame);
     return err;
 }
